Tiki Tonga Blend No.2
The No.2 is an excellent full-bodied blend that carries well through milky drinks. This blend is heavy and punchy with a powerful liquorice kick and throwing in a cocoa finish. Earthy notes scrum together smoothly with a subtle spicy undertone. Coffee Blend - Indian Washed Robusta, Kenyan Arabica, Brazilian Mogiana Arabica, Ethiopian Djimmah Arabica

Tiki Tonga Blend No.10
A single origin Brazilian Yellow Bourbon. The No.10 kicks off with a sweet and creamy mouthfeel. An immensely skilful and beautifully rounded player. Distributing bold notes of roasted nuts and caramel with a bittersweet cocoa conversion. Being a single origin coffee means that the beans in No.10 are from one country and in this case, one variety of coffee plant – the Yellow Bourbon. Yellow Bourbon refers to the variety of coffee plant from which these beans are picked. The name Yellow Bourbon comes from the fact that, unlike most coffee varieties, which produce rich red berries when ripe, the Yellow Bourbon variety produces yellow fruit making them a distinctive and recognisable coffee variety
